2015-12-13 22 views
0

在PHP应用程序中更改引导的DateTimePicker,有了这个代码,显示的DateTimePicker:在PHP应用程序

return ' 
     <div class="input-group input-medium date datetimepicker">' . 
      input_tag('fields[' . $field['id'] . ']',$value,array('class'=>'form-control fieldtype_input_datetime'. ($field['is_required']==1 ? ' required':''))) . 
      '<span class="input-group-btn"> 
      <button class="btn btn-default date-set" type="button"><i class="fa fa-calendar"></i></button> 
      </span> 
     </div>'; 

的日期选择是:

https://github.com/eternicode/bootstrap-datepicker

,我有另一种的DateTimePicker这是Jalali波斯引导datetimepicker。我上传的位置:

http://www.freeuploadsite.com/do.php?id=83102

而这种代码的地方日期选择器:

<div class="input-group"> 
       <div class="input-group-addon" data-mddatetimepicker="true" data-trigger="click" data-targetselector="#exampleInput3"> 
        <span class="glyphicon glyphicon-calendar"></span> 
       </div> 
       <input type="text" class="form-control" id="exampleInput3" placeholder="تاریخ" data-mddatetimepicker="true" data-placement="right" data-englishnumber="true" /> 
      </div> 

不过,这并不在应用程序工作。我只是用下面的代码替换上面的代码。它显示按钮和文本区域,但是当我点击什么显示。我检查了... js和css加载正确。 我做错了吗?

回答

0

你有没有初始化插件的地方?我看不到它

$('#exampleInput3').datepicker() 

我想你想附加到'exampleInput3',但你可以选择任何其他选择器。

这样,你的日期选择器具有哪些元素被应用到插件说。

+0

它在哪里使用选择器本身?我的意思是在上面的代码中。 我可以用这种方式使用选择器吗?我的意思是在PHP文件中?我查过并没有工作。 – meph

+0

我的回答只是让你知道你需要初始化插件,如果你不这样做显然不工作。 – Franco

+0

此外,我看到你正在使用一些我不知道的框架,所以你需要在这里发布一些相关的代码,以便看到问题出在哪里:) – Franco